Part I: Calculating Student Loan Payments for Fannie Mae. – Fannie Mae guideline b3-6-05: monthly debt Obligations (Student Loans) provides the following guidance for student loan evaluation. First, all student loans, regardless of repayment status must be included in the qualifying debt ratios. There is no circumstance under Fannie Mae’s guidelines where student loan payments may be excluded.

In a Nutshell Fannie Mae raised the DTI ratio limit to 50 percent from 45 percent in July 2017. It will help some borrowers with strong credit and incomes in expensive markets, but will do little for other buyers who have other loan options, mortgage experts say.
